Ikebana is the Japanese art of flower arrangement. This traditional and formal art may seem esoteric, but this is not the case. Anyone is capable of creating a fantastic work of art by themselves after acquiring the basic concepts and fundamental skills of this art.
Learning ikebana promotes a better understanding of the Japanese view of nature; a crucial step in appreciating the unique aesthetics, emotions and thoughts that merge to create this visual art form. Flower arranging used to be a required "mannerism" for well-educated men, such as samurais or monks.
